Product Overview: Ameriprise® Certificates

There are four types of Ameriprise certificates, each designed to meet different investment objectives.

Ameriprise Flexible Savings Certificate

The Ameriprise Flexible Savings Certificate is a fixed-rate investment with competitive returns that lets you choose a term from six months to three years.

Ameriprise Stock Market Certificate

This unique investment offers interest tied to the potentially higher returns of the stock market, up to a maximum interest rate or a lower participation in the returns of the stock market, plus an interest rate guaranteed by Ameriprise Certificate Company.

Ameriprise Market Strategy Certificate

Features similar to those of the Stock Market Certificate with the flexibility of having your contributions invested systematically over a period of time. This unique investment offers interest tied to the potentially higher returns of the stock market, up to a maximum interest rate, or a lower participation in the returns of the stock market, plus an interest rate guaranteed by the Ameriprise Certificate Company. Does not guarantee a profit or protect against lack of returns in a declining market.

Ameriprise Installment Certificate

An Ameriprise Installment Certificate offers base yields, plus a bonus for regular saving, which can give a substantial boost to your total return.

Investors in the Ameriprise Stock Market Certificate and Market Strategy Certificate may not receive interest if the underlying index is flat or lower at the end of the period than it was at the beginning of the period.

Ameriprise certificates are backed by reserves of cash and qualified assets on deposit. The assets backing the certificates have varying ratings and generally increase in market value as interest rates fall, and decrease in market value as interest rates rise. Bank CDs are FDIC insured.
